We explore the uncomfortable truth that we often decide first and invent logic later, a concept Nate Sowder uses to challenge how we trust user feedback. While Brad Frost argues for a creative infinite beyond technical limits, we also untangle the community's struggles with balancing imperfect research against the paralysis of waiting for perfect data. From the friction of AI content filters to the burnout of solo designers, we examine where expertise meets the reality of shipping work.
About The Feed & The Thread
The Feed & The Thread is a daily summary of UX articles found in the industry and some light-touch updates from the UX Community found in online forums. It’s brief, and meant as a light-touch overview of what’s happening across UX.
